Technische Universität Dresden (TU Dresden) is a premier German research university that pioneered the CONPrint3D technology, a revolutionary on-site robotic concrete 3D printing process. By adapting established construction machinery like truck-mounted concrete pumps into large-scale robotic manipulators, the university enables the automated, formwork-free creation of monolithic reinforced concrete structures directly on construction sites. Their interdisciplinary research integrates advanced materials science, computational design, and BIM data management to significantly reduce construction costs and carbon footprints while expanding architectural design possibilities.
